Some cards will have a variable APR and others will have a fixed-rate APR. Variable rate credit cards have an interest rate that is tied to an index such as the U.S. prime rate. When the U.S. prime rate changes, the interest rate on those credit cards will change as well. A credit card with a variable APR may change monthly, quarterly or yearly.
